The government has a hugely ambitious target of cutting carbon emissions by 80% by 2050, but just how achievable is this? According to the Royal Academy of Engineering, it's not very likely unless we radically rethink the way our homes are heated. Their latest report looks at new developments, taxes and incentives for improving energy efficiency, and their argument is the fact that the latest energy efficiency standards will only apply to new homes, and mean most homes will be unaffected.They have found that even if all homes were modernised with gas boilers, they couldn't continue to be heated with natural...

Applications for the government’s new £15 million Renewable Heat Premium Payment scheme will begin to be accepted from August 1 onwards, and the scheme will run until March 2012, supporting up to 25,000 installations. This particular scheme is aimed at households who are not heated by mains gas, and who are forced to rely on heating which produces a higher carbon footprint and also costs more. This includes the use of electric fires and oil fired central heating systems to heat homes.Potential participants of this scheme will be able to apply for up to £1250 of funding which will help towards...
